Ven Pongal

Ven pongal is spicy version of pongal, the popular dish from South Indian cuisine.

Prepared with rice, milk, green gram dal as main ingredients Ven Pongal is an ideal

breakfast. Easy to cook and ready to serve, the recipe
of Ven pongal is here

Ingredients
Ven Pongal

* 1 cup: Raw rice
* ½ cup: Milk
* 1/3 cup: Green gram dal
* 11/2 tsp: Black pepper
* 1 tsp: Cumin seeds
* 1 tbs: Broken cashew nuts
* 1 tbs: Finely cut ginger (optional)
* A few: Curry leaves
* 2 tbs: Ghee
* 5 cup: Water
* Salt to taste


Method

1. Wash rice and dal and cook them together in five cups of water for 10 minutes.
2. Add salt, curry leaves and ginger with half a cup of milk. Simmer for a minute and

remove from fire.
3. Fry cashew nuts, pepper and cumin seeds in ghee.
4. Pour this over the rice-dal mixture.
5. Mix well and serve steaming hot with ghee on top.
